欢迎光临
我们一直在努力
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告
广告

从入门到高级:云服务器性能调优的全方位教程

云服务器性能调优的全方位教程从入门到高级

一、引言

随着云计算技术的快速发展,越来越多的企业和个人选择使用云服务器来托管应用、存储数据和进行各种计算任务。

如何对云服务器进行性能调优,以充分利用资源、提高运行效率和降低成本,成为许多用户关注的焦点。

本文将带你从入门到高级,全面了解云服务器性能调优的全方位知识。

二、云服务器入门

1. 云服务器基本概念

云服务器是一种基于云计算技术的虚拟服务器,具有弹性扩展、按需付费、快速部署等特点。

用户可以通过云服务提供商的在线平台,远程管理和配置云服务器。

2. 云服务器的选择

在选择云服务器时,需要根据实际需求考虑服务器的规格(如CPU、内存、存储)、操作系统、网络带宽等因素。

三、云服务器性能监控

1. 性能指标

云服务器的性能指标包括CPU使用率、内存占用、磁盘I/O、网络带宽等。

了解这些指标是性能调优的基础。

2. 监控工具

使用监控工具(如Server Density、Zabbix等)可以实时监控云服务器的性能数据,以便及时发现和解决问题。

四、云服务器性能优化策略

1. 初级优化

(1)优化系统配置:根据服务器规格和操作系统,合理配置系统参数,如调整JVM内存大小、优化数据库连接池等。

(2)安装必要的安全补丁和软件更新:确保服务器运行在安全、稳定的环境下。

(3)定期清理无用文件和临时文件:释放磁盘空间,提高系统性能。

2. 中级优化

(1)负载均衡:通过部署负载均衡器,将流量分散到多个服务器上,提高整体性能。

(2)缓存优化:使用缓存技术(如Redis、Memcached等),减少数据库访问次数,提高响应速度。

(3)并发处理:优化应用程序的并发处理机制,提高服务器处理请求的能力。

3. 高级优化

(1)容器化部署:使用Docker等容器技术,实现应用的轻量级隔离和快速部署。

(2)微服务架构:将应用拆分为多个微服务,降低系统复杂度,提高可扩展性和性能。

(3)自动化运维:通过DevOps实践,实现自动化部署、监控和运维,提高系统稳定性和性能。

五、案例分析

以某电商网站为例,通过云服务器性能调优,实现了系统的快速响应和高并发处理能力。

对数据库进行了优化,使用了缓存技术减少直接查询数据库的次数;通过负载均衡技术,将用户请求分散到多个服务器上处理;最后,采用了容器化部署和微服务架构,提高了系统的可扩展性和稳定性。

经过调优后,系统的响应时间降低了30%,并发处理能力提高了50%。

六、总结与建议

云服务器性能调优是一个持续的过程,需要根据实际情况不断调整和优化。以下是一些建议:

1. 持续关注性能指标:定期查看和分析云服务器的性能指标,了解系统的运行状态。

2. 使用监控工具:选择合适的监控工具,实时监控服务器的性能数据。

3. 定期评估和调整:根据业务需求,定期评估和调整系统配置和性能优化策略。

4. 学习新技术:关注云计算和虚拟化技术的最新发展,学习新的性能优化技术。

5. 寻求专业支持:对于复杂的性能问题,可以寻求云服务提供商或专业机构的支持。

通过本文的学习,希望读者能够对云服务器性能调优有更全面的了解,并能够在实际应用中取得良好的效果。

赞(0)
未经允许不得转载:优乐评测网 » 从入门到高级:云服务器性能调优的全方位教程

优乐评测网 找服务器 更专业 更方便 更快捷!

专注IDC行业资源共享发布,给大家带来方便快捷的资源查找平台!

联系我们